The partnership established between the Grand Lodge and Brock University, St. Catharines, has proven most productive and mutually beneficial to both educational institutions. Its beginning was with the initiative of the Heritage Lodge No. 730 to support and maintain the Mas
onic collection in the James A. Gibson Library, and continuing with the posting on line of the Proceedings of Grand Lodge from 1855 to 2010.
The Annual Dr. Charles A. Sankey Lecture in Masonic Studies funded by the College of Freemasonry is now in its fourth year with Prof. Joy Porter from the University of Hull, Hull, U.K. The title of her lecture is "Native American Freemasonry: Joseph Brant to the 21st Century" and is taking place on Sunday March 24, 2013 at Brock University. The first phase is culminating in the joint sponsorship of the International Conference on the History of Freemasonry in 2015 supported by contributions to the Grand Master’s Project 2937 during 2009-2011. The study of fraternalism in general and Freemasonry in particular has been advanced significantly.
